| colloidal |
A suspension of finely divided particles in a dispersing medium; particles do not rapidly settle out of suspension and are not readily filtered.

| colloid chemistry |
The application of chemistry to systems and substances, and the problems of emulsions, mists, foams, and suspensions.

| colloid osmotic hemolysis |
The swelling and rupture of red blood cells when they become excessively permeable to sodium and fill with water.
